Detailed Itinerary

  • Day 1 : Arrival in Kathmandu

    Arrive at Tribhuvan International Airport, meet our representative, and transfer to your hotel. Evening at leisure.
    Overnight in Kathmandu.

  • Day 2 : Kathmandu – Patan Sightseeing

    Visit Kathmandu Durbar Square, home to palaces of Malla and Shah kings, and the Kumari Ghar (Living Goddess Temple). Continue to Swoyambhunath Stupa, perched on a hill with panoramic valley views.
    Afternoon excursion to Patan Durbar Square, including Krishna Mandir, Royal Bath, and Hiranya Varna Mahavihar.
    Overnight in Kathmandu.

  • Day 3 : Kathmandu – Bhaktapur & Heritage Sites

    Visit Pashupatinath Temple, Nepal’s most sacred Hindu shrine, and witness the cremation rituals on the Bagmati River banks. Continue to Boudhanath Stupa, a major Tibetan Buddhist center.
    In the afternoon, explore the well-preserved medieval town of Bhaktapur, famous for its traditional Newari culture and Durbar Square.
    Overnight in Kathmandu.

  • Day 4 : Kathmandu ➝ Lhasa

    Fly over the Himalayas to Gonggar Airport (Lhasa). Scenic drive along the Yarlung Tsangpo and Kyichu Rivers to Lhasa city.
    Overnight in Lhasa.

  • Day 5 : Lhasa – Potala Palace and Sera Monastery

    Morning visit to the magnificent Potala Palace, once the winter residence of the Dalai Lamas.
    Afternoon visit to Sera Monastery, renowned for its vibrant monk debates and rich history.
    Overnight in Lhasa.

  • Day 6 : Lhasa – Drepung Monastery, Jokhang Temple & Barkhor Market

    Morning visit to Drepung Monastery, the largest in Tibet and an important center of the Gelugpa school of Buddhism.
    Afternoon visit to the sacred Jokhang Temple, home to the revered golden statue of Shakyamuni Buddha, and explore the bustling Barkhor Market.
    Overnight in Lhasa.

  • Day 7 : Lhasa ➝ Kathmandu

    Transfer to the airport for your return flight to Kathmandu or onward destination.
    Overnight in Kathmandu or departure connection.

  • Day 8 : Departure from Kathmandu

    Transfer to the airport for your onward journey.
